Output 75f822f49c66b30ddb8ed3637beebd1fcc72073cae61a530cead3fcdb30106c5:0

value
431586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ec0dafefcbbae3c7574504a260a3f8eefea289fd OP_EQUAL
address
3PD9npfuKqx5ujFSaauEe2rFgk4G85YP9u
transaction
75f822f49c66b30ddb8ed3637beebd1fcc72073cae61a530cead3fcdb30106c5
confirmations
369096
spent
true